Abstract

fetched live from OpenAlex

Background In the INBUILD trial with progressive fibrosing ILDs other than idiopathic pulmonary fibrosis (IPF), nintedanib reduced the FVC decline (mL/year) over 52 weeks by 57% versus placebo. Objectives To assess the rate of decline in FVC in subjects with RA-ILD in INBUILD. Methods Subjects had a chronic fibrosing ILD other than IPF, reticular abnormality with traction bronchiectasis (with or without honeycombing) of >10% on HRCT, FVC ≥45% predicted, DL CO ≥30%–<80% predicted, and met criteria for progression of ILD within the 24 months before screening, despite appropriate management in clinical practice. Patients taking stable doses of approved medications to treat RA or connective tissue disease could participate, except those taking azathioprine, cyclosporine, mycophenolate mofetil, tacrolimus, rituximab, cyclophosphamide, or oral glucocorticoids >20 mg/day. We analysed the FVC decline (mL/year) over 52 weeks and adverse events (AEs) in RA-ILD. Results 663 subjects received trial medication, 89 had RA-ILD (42 nintedanib, 47 placebo), 60.7% were male, 64.0% were current or former smokers, 86.5% had a usual interstitial pneumonia (UIP)-like pattern on HRCT; 93.3% had rheumatologist confirmed RA diagnosis. At baseline, 21.3% were taking biologic disease-modifying anti-rheumatic drugs (DMARDs), 53.9% non-biologic DMARDs and 73.0% glucocorticoids (≤20 mg/day prednisone or equivalent). Mean (SD) age was 66.9 (9.6) years, time since RA-/ILD diagnosis was 9.9 (9.4)/ 3.6 (3.2) years, FVC 71.5 (16.2) % predicted and C-reactive protein 13.7 (22.5) mg/L. Consistent with the overall trial population the adjusted mean (SE) FVC decline over 52 weeks was -82.6 (41.3) mL/year with nintedanib vs. -199.3 (36.2) mL/year with placebo (difference 116.7 mL/year [95% CI 7.4, 226.1]; p=0.037) (Figure) and the most common AE in RA-ILD was diarrhoea (reported in 54.8% of the nintedanib and 25.5% of the placebo group). AEs led to permanent discontinuation of trial drug in 19.0% of subjects in nintedanib and 12.8% in placebo group. Conclusions In INBUILD, nintedanib slowed the FVC decline in patients with progressive fibrosing RA-ILD, with AEs that were manageable for most patients. The efficacy and safety of nintedanib in subjects with RA-ILD were consistent with those observed in the overall trial population.
